Below, we compare Rutgers New Jersey Medical School (Rutgers New Jersey Medical School) and SUNY Downstate Medical Center College of Medicine (SUNY Downstate College of Medicine) with important considerations for medical school admissions.
  • Both schools are public.
  • Rutgers New Jersey Medical School's tuition is more expensive than SUNY Downstate College of Medicine.
  • SUNY Downstate College of Medicine's acceptance rate is lower than Rutgers New Jersey Medical School.
  • Rutgers New Jersey Medical School's MCAT score is higher than SUNY Downstate College of Medicine.
  • Rutgers New Jersey Medical School's GPA is higher than SUNY Downstate College of Medicine.
  • SUNY Downstate College of Medicine is larger than Rutgers New Jersey Medical School with more enrolled students.
  • SUNY Downstate College of Medicine is older than Rutgers New Jersey Medical School.
